What is the difference between Live In Orthodontic Lab Technician vs Dental Laboratory Technician?

AspectLive In Orthodontic Lab TechnicianDental Laboratory Technician
CredentialsCertification often preferred, specialized in orthodonticsCertification varies; general dental lab skills
Work EnvironmentLaboratory setting, orthodontic clinics, or onsite at dental officesLaboratories producing various dental prosthetics
Industry UsagePrimarily in orthodontics, focusing on braces and alignersBroader dental industry, including crowns, bridges, dentures

Live In Orthodontic Lab Technicians specialize in creating orthodontic appliances like braces and aligners, often working directly in orthodontic labs or clinics. Dental Laboratory Technicians have a broader role, producing a variety of dental prosthetics for general dentistry. While both roles require similar certifications and work in lab environments, their focus areas and industry applications differ significantly.

Position Summary

The Orthodontic Technician is responsible for assisting in the fabrication and finishing of orthodontic appliances under the supervision of experienced technicians.  This position is ideal for individuals who are detail oriented, eager to learn, and interested in developing a career within the dental laboratory industry.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in the fabrication of orthodontic appliances, including retainers, expanders, space maintainers, and other removable devices
  • Pour and trim dental models from impressions and digital workflows
  • Prepare and organize cases for production
  • Perform appliance finishing, polishing, and quality checks according to established standards
  • Read, and interpret prescriptions and work instructions
  • Maintain accurate case documentation and production records
  • Clean and maintain workstations equipment and tools
  • Follow all laboratory safety protocols and quality control procedures
  • Collaborate with team members to meet production schedule and turnaround times
  • Participate in ongoing training and skill development opportunities
